Ok so it is very apparent to people in MW that a family jumped planets early and with a popper.

This is the Einstein jump.


The Einstein jump relies upon using endu at BoR efficiently (each explorer costs 5 endu) and spending excess cash. It also is a bit reliant upon the endu market remaining high for two days in the early stages and an iron and endu bottoming out after that.

As of now the jump was 'mixed'. We had a banker who was very late starting (he said he would be on at start) and this significantly affected portions of the jump.

However we were able to correct and the start did include three planets for CF's as well (thus giving us maximum space to grow on with the saved endu).


If endu had remained locked at 50 for 54 hours we would have 'broken even' with other fams with 4 bankers who employed a CF rush plan. Then even if endu dropped we could not just 'keep up' but we would surpass other families by an additional 10k gc a tick. That and the fact we had so many planets so early of course.

Meanwhile the population grows, we get security on them, we watch the population grow, and try a pop banker from the start with some serious growth.


I think it will pay off.


I also think as people do the math of the strategy themselves we will see variations of this done at BoR where at least 8 planets are handed to a pop banker asap to get growth.


Yes I used TO's as well to increase the total income of my population.


If I knew resources were going to drop so fast... I might have made it 32 planets after all. But i predicted resources staying high for longer. Thus we went resource heavy to compensate for expected market conditions and to support the heavier expected income.


Not only is the pop rush plan viable, it is flexible. If iron stays high you make CF's for cash. If iron is low when pop is getting near full you make LQ's.

Worst case you can also transfer a planet or two out for construction of resourcer stuff if the market is absolutely stuffed and way to profitable. I easily predict that I shall be the first to breach 1 million a tick in income barring some hate from someone or such.

there's one serious flaw in your strat,flint:
-20% research

Even if u were the fastest to start with this early round plan, you're [spending money on hookers] mid round and late round when research is the most important aspect of banking

At the start it's all about fast return on investment. a pure pop start is the opposite of that

i think if u went heavy ress, and focussed on building lq on home only, u could get somewhere, with 50% pop growth its full fast so u start asap on LQ. stick to CF on the explored planets 80% and wait for lq for them last 20%. those cf's allready would have payed back their costs when ud decide to replace them. (gets even cheaper if ud prebuild them first)

this wouldv made sure your income was as good as the other fams were, and stil be able to get 100-200k pop on a very short notice. now all we gotta do is wait til someone ops your popper.
